Super Art Gocoo magazine - July 1980 Ruth Marten the uncannySuper Art Gocoo magazine July 1980 issue an interesting magazine published in the late 70s and 80s by Parco Gallery in Tokyo. Every issue has multiple illustration galleries, often with airbrush style work & graphic design and illustration legends (Kiyoshi Awazu, Tadanori Yokoo, Aquirax Uno), plus music features and articles in Japanese.
